Advantages and Drawbacks of Home Elevators

Home elevators have become increasingly popular in recent years as more families seek ways to improve accessibility within their homes. However, like all major home renovations, installing a home elevator comes with advantages and drawbacks.

One of the biggest advantages of having a home elevator is improved mobility for those who have difficulty navigating stairs, such as individuals with disabilities or seniors. Not only does it offer easier access to all levels of a home, but also provides a sense of independence and self-sufficiency, allowing individuals to move freely without assistance. Additionally, home elevators can add value to a property by making it more attractive to potential buyers who are looking for a home that is accessible and accommodating.

Another advantage of installing a home elevator is the convenience it offers. Carrying heavy groceries or furniture up multiple flights of stairs becomes a thing of the past when you have an elevator in your home, making daily tasks much easier and faster. It can also be very useful during special occasions where guests may come over, especially those who may require assistance with climbing stairs.

However, there are also some drawbacks to consider before installing a home elevator. The most obvious drawback is cost, which can be quite substantial depending on the type of elevator and its features. Maintenance costs are another factor to keep in mind since the proper upkeep of an elevator is essential for safety reasons and preventing costly repairs.

Additionally, some homeowners may find that having an elevator takes up valuable space within their homes or may not fit in with their interior design preferences. Lastly, there’s also the potential for downtime during power outages if the elevator doesn’t have a backup power source.

Cost Analysis in Houston’s Market

One of the main factors that deter homeowners from installing a home elevator is cost. A variety of factors can affect the price, including the type of elevator, installation requirements, features, and materials used.

Elevators designed for commercial buildings are typically more expensive than those designed for residential purposes since they must meet more stringent standards. Hydraulic elevators tend to be more expensive than cable-driven models because they require more intricate components and installation processes. Additionally, custom-designed elevators or those with specialized finishes can increase costs as well.

Another factor that affects cost is whether any modifications or renovations need to be made to the home to accommodate an elevator. This includes creating additional space around where the elevator will go and modifying electrical systems to support its operation.

Adherence to Safety Standards

Adherence to safety standards is crucial when it comes to home elevator installations. Elevator accidents can result in severe personal injury or even death in extreme cases. For this reason, proper safety precautions must be taken during installation and use.

Experienced elevator technicians are aware of the safety standards that must be followed to ensure optimal performance. They know how to properly install safety features such as emergency stop buttons, interlocks, and alarm systems that meet industry standards and local building codes.

For example, the installation of safety gears, brakes, and hoistway doors are mandatory for ensuring occupant safety during the operation of the elevator. An experienced installation team knows how to install each of these components correctly and test them to ensure smooth functioning.

In contrast, inexperienced teams may overlook critical elements in installing an elevator that could lead to future accidents or malfunctions.
